What does Rocketship Spark Academy District spend the most on?
Based on 42 tracked contracts, Rocketship Spark Academy District spends most on Capital Projects (29), Grants (6), Professional Services (3), Recreation & Community Services (3), and Administration & Finance (1). Contract types include P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, FINANCIAL_SERVICES, FACILITIES, Contract Extension, and Agreement. Who are Rocketship Spark Academy District's current vendors?
Rocketship Spark Academy District currently works with vendors including WELLDOM INC, EDTHEORY LLC, SANTA CLARA COUNTY OFFICE OF EDUCATION, MT. DIABLO UNIFIED SCHOOL DISTRICT, BIGBREAK, SWENSON & ASSOCIATES, and NOB HILL CATERING INC. These vendors span contract types like P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ES, FINANCIAL_SERVICES, FACILITIES, Contract Extension, and Agreement.
